Sensitive-file deletion via command argument injection
Published Mar 10, 2026 · Updated Mar 10, 2026
Argument injection in affected Fortinet FortiDeceptor releases allows remote authenticated users to delete sensitive files. The CLI request path passes crafted HTTP input to a command without neutralizing argument delimiters, so injected arguments select files for deletion; Fortinet has not identified the command or endpoint. Exploitation requires an authenticated super-admin profile with CLI access, and the reported consequence is file deletion rather than code execution.
